What Causes DSC Failure?
2 Answers
DSC failure refers to the malfunction of the vehicle stability control system, leading to its deactivation. The DSC system is designed to prevent driving hazards, so it typically activates in dangerous situations such as impending wheel lock-up, understeer, or oversteer. During normal driving, it functions similarly to a vehicle without ESP. Below is a detailed introduction: 1. DSC Overview: DSC stands for Dynamic Stability Control, an advanced extension of traction control or anti-skid systems. It ensures optimal traction and stability when the vehicle is turning. 2. DSC Components: The DSC system includes ABS (Anti-lock Braking System), ASC (Automatic Stability Control), MSR (Engine Drag Torque Control), DBC (Dynamic Body Control), CBC (Cornering Brake Control), and DTC (Dynamic Traction Control). Through various sensors like wheel speed sensors, steering angle sensors, and lateral acceleration sensors, the system detects potential skidding, rollover, fishtailing, or oversteering and intervenes to maintain stable driving conditions.

There are quite a few reasons for DSC failure, with the most common being faulty or dirty wheel speed sensors, as they directly monitor wheel speed and affect stability. Another factor is electrical system problems, such as blown fuses or poor wiring connections, especially in older cars that have been driven for a long time and are prone to aging and short circuits. Software malfunctions can also be the culprit, with the electronic control unit falsely reporting errors or needing a program update. If the battery is low or the alternator isn’t performing well, the system may fail.
